This presentation explores disorganized speech as a core manifestation of schizophrenia, rooted in cognitive disruptions. It covers the historical context of schizophrenia research, emphasizing the significance of thought disorders and earlier clinical approaches. The discussion highlights the potential of disorganized speech as a measurable biomarker, examining its hereditary and genetic aspects to enhance understanding and research in this domain.
